We are searching for a Milk Bank Technician - someone to store, prepare and deliver a mother's breast milk and/or pasteurized donor human milk to hospitalized infants. To provide assistance to mothers of hospitalized infants expressing milk for their infants in a manner appropriate and as necessary.

Think you have what it takes?   This position will be 8 hr shifts x 5 days a week

  • Knowledge of milk preparation, measurement, and sanitary techniques 
  • Ability to maintain sanitation levels, operate computers on a basic level, and operate electronic scales, analyzer and centrifuge with a higher degree of accuracy

Requirements

~1 min read
  • High School Diploma or GED
  • 6 months healthcare related work experience 

    ** an associate or bachelor’s degree in nutrition, healthcare or related field can substitute for 6 months of experience**

  • 1 year nutrition or breastfeeding education experience

Responsibilities

~1 min read
  • Accurately weighs, measures, and prepares mother’s own and/or pasteurized donor human milk for infant feeding per physician’s orders
  • Calculates accurate quantities of mother’s own/pasteurized donor human milk and human milk fortifiers based on diet order
  • Monitors all needed milk preparation/storage supplies and discards expired nutritional additives
  • Uses and practices proper storage times and temperatures for human milk at all times to minimize bacterial growth and
  • according to written standards. Rotates stored milk to minimize undue wastage
  • Enters patient charges into EPM computer system on a daily basis
  • Prepares labels to accurately identify mother’s own/pasteurized donor human milk for individually prepared feedings
  • Maintains competencies required to efficiently and effectively utilize milk preparation/storage equipment and supplies
  • Communicates with parents delivering milk to the Milk Bank to ensure proper collection and storage of mother’s
  • own/pasteurized donor human milk
  • Communicates with appropriate medical/nursing personnel for needed assistance with feeding order clarification
  • Communicates inventory shortages or special-order needs to Manager as appropriate to meet patient care needs
